General Info
In Block
1958035efa983553948c1d314d44dd831ce5ab75f07942646602678bc091bee6
In block height
Total Input
1391036.41314233 RDD
Total Output
1391697.46909093 RDD
Transaction Details
Fee
0 RDD
mined Tue, 02 Jul 2024 21:39:09 UTC
From
1391036.41314233 RDD